On Wed, Sep 09, 1998 at 03:05:35PM -0700, Gordon Chaffee wrote:
> I'm looking at adding some optional symlink support to the vfat
> filesystem to make it easier to do things like build kernels or
> other things that require symlinks. Basically, a symlink would be a file
> with the contents of something like:
>
> :SymLink -> asm-i386

If you're going to do this, please make it compatible with the format
used by Cygwin32 (= GNU utilities + Unix emulation on Windows).

I don't know the format, but starting from www.cygnus.com should get you
there pretty quick.
